Food safety breaches: Maha cracks down on Blink Commerce, Reliance Retail

Maharashtra FDA suspended Blink Commerce Pvt Ltd’s food licence for severe cockroach infestation and hygiene and storage lapses at a Mumbai facility, according to officials. It is investigating Reliance Retail Ltd after alleged live larvae were found in a “Laxmi Narayan” kaju katli batch at an ARD Cinemall outlet in Buldhana. Samples were seized and sent for lab testing.

Why Blink Charging (BLNK) Stock Is Falling Today

Blink Charging (BLNK) shares fell about 4% after the company asked Nasdaq for an additional 180-day compliance period to regain the minimum $1 bid price for 10 straight trading days, extending the deadline to Jan. 25, 2027. The request reflects ongoing cash burn concerns and could risk delisting if requirements aren’t met.

Adani Group stocks rise after US court dismisses fraud charges against Gautam Adani, Sagar Adani

Adani Group shares rose after a US court dismissed with prejudice fraud-related charges against Gautam Adani, Sagar Adani and Vneet Jaain. The US District Judge Nicholas Garaufis accepted the DOJ’s narrow “puffery” argument and barred reopening the case. Adani Enterprises gained 2.6% to ₹3,080; Adani Green Energy rose 3.5%. The SEC civil settlement is $18 million.
